Trabajo de html sandy gutierrez

13
Instituto Tecnológico de Nor-Oriente ITECNOR Ing. Omar Sandoval Informática básica II HTML Gutiérrez Aldana Sandy floridalma. Perito en industria alimentaria 5to A Llanos de la fragua Zacapa 23/02/2015

Transcript of Trabajo de html sandy gutierrez

Page 1: Trabajo de html sandy gutierrez

Instituto Tecnológico de Nor-Oriente

ITECNOR

Ing. Omar Sandoval

Informática básica II

HTML

Gutiérrez Aldana Sandy floridalma.

Perito en industria alimentaria

5to A

Llanos de la fragua Zacapa 23/02/2015

Page 2: Trabajo de html sandy gutierrez

¿Qué es HTML?

HTML, siglas de Hipertexto Markup Lenguaje («lenguaje de marcas de hipertexto»), hace referencia al lenguaje de marcado para la elaboración de páginas web. Es un estándar que sirve de referencia para la elaboración de páginas web en sus diferentes versiones, define una estructura básica y un código (denominado código HTML) para la definición de contenido de una página web, como texto, imágenes, entre otros. Es un estándar a cargo de la W3C, organización dedicada a la estandarización de casi todas las tecnologías ligadas a la web, sobre todo en lo referente a su escritura e interpretación.

El lenguaje HTML basa su filosofía de desarrollo en la referenciarían. Para añadir un elemento externo a la página (imagen, vídeo, script, entre otros.), este no se incrusta directamente en el código de la página, sino que se hace una referencia a la ubicación de dicho elemento mediante texto. De este modo, la página web contiene sólo texto mientras que recae en el navegador web (interpretador del código) la tarea de unir todos los elementos y visualizar la página final. Al ser un estándar, HTML busca ser un lenguaje que permita que cualquier página web escrita en una determinada versión, pueda ser interpretada de la misma forma (estándar) por cualquier navegador web actualizado.

Sin embargo, a lo largo de sus diferentes versiones, se han incorporado y suprimido diversas características, con el fin de hacerlo más eficiente y facilitar el desarrollo de páginas web compatibles con distintos navegadores y plataformas (PC de escritorio, portátiles, teléfonos inteligentes, tabletas, etc.). Sin embargo, para interpretar correctamente una nueva versión de HTML, los desarrolladores de navegadores web deben

Page 3: Trabajo de html sandy gutierrez

incorporar estos cambios y el usuario debe ser capaz de usar la nueva versión del navegador con los cambios incorporados. Normalmente los cambios son aplicados mediante parches de actualización automática (Firefox, Crome) u ofreciendo una nueva versión del navegador con todos los cambios incorporados, en un sitio web de descarga oficial (Internet Explorer). Un navegador no actualizado no será capaz de interpretar correctamente una página web escrita en una versión de HTML superior a la que pueda interpretar, lo que obliga muchas veces a los desarrolladores a aplicar técnicas y cambios que permitan corregir problemas de visualización e incluso de interpretación de código HTML. Así mismo, las páginas escritas en una versión anterior de HTML deberían ser actualizadas o reescritas, lo que no siempre se cumple. Es por ello que ciertos navegadores aún mantienen la capacidad de interpretar páginas web de versiones HTML anteriores. Por estas razones, aún existen diferencias entre distintos navegadores y versiones al interpretar una misma página web.

El físico nuclear Tim Bernés Lee definió la primera versión de HTML en el año 1989. Después evolucionaría hasta llegar a cuatro versiones más. HTML 4 fue la última en 1998. Después llegaría el lenguaje que aun utilizamos, el XHTML hijo del XML y el HTML.

No caigamos en el error de pensar que uno supone la desaparición del otro pues el XHTML necesita del HTML para ser entendido por el ordenador. En otras palabras, el HTML abre las puertas y el XHTML trabaja.

Quisiera utilizar las siguientes líneas para contaros la historia del HTML, pero no sin antes hacer constar que detrás de unos pocos nombres y fechas hay mucho más trabajo.

Page 4: Trabajo de html sandy gutierrez

Quisiera utilizar las siguientes líneas para contaros la historia del HTML, pero no sin antes hacer constar que detrás de unos pocos nombres y fechas hay mucho más trabajo, conexiones, ideas y nombres que por cuestiones de espacio, tiempo y claridad quedan exentas de este artículo.

Ante todo, definir de que estamos hablando exactamente: HTML es el acrónimo de HyperText Markup Lenguaje, que traducido a nuestro idioma es Lenguaje de Marcación de Texto. Es una herramienta para que el ordenador conectado a Internet interprete como visualizar el documento.

No es un lenguaje de programación y no tiene compilador alguno, así que si hay algún error que no detecta lo visualizará de la manera en la que lo ha entendido. Es un sistema de etiquetas que indica al ordenador cuando hay que señalar una cursiva, separar un párrafo o definir el color del texto.

De todas maneras, tiene sus limitaciones así que a menudo se utilizan otras herramientas como las hojas de estilo, que le dan mayor libertad al diseñador. En concreto, el HTML le da las indicaciones mencionadas al programa cliente, el browser o navegador para que presente el documento en la pantalla de la manera adecuada.

El HTML se hizo popular por su sencillez, era fácil de aprender y eso lo hace accesible a mayor número de personas. Estos documentos web deben estar escritos con el mismo “lenguaje” para que diferentes ordenadores puedan leerlos, si alguien utiliza un sistema diferente no podrá compartir su información con los que usan el HTML ni podrá visualizar los de los demás.

Page 5: Trabajo de html sandy gutierrez

Por eso la tendencia es crear un estándar que evoluciona poco a poco y que es compatible con la versión anterior.

Nombre Etiqueta inicial

Etiqueta final

Des. DTD Descripción

a <a> </a> Origen o destino del vínculo

Abbr <abbr> </abbr> Abreviatura (p.ej.: WWW, HTTP, etc.)

Acronym <acronym>

</acronym>

Page 6: Trabajo de html sandy gutierrez

Address <address>

</address> Información sobre el autor

Apple <applet> </applet> D L Applet JavaÁrea <área> Prohibido Área de un

mapa de imágenes en el lado del cliente

b <b> </b> Estilo de texto en negrita

Base <base> Prohibido URI base del documento

Base Font

<base Font>

Prohibido D L Tamaño base de fuente

Vado <vado> </bdo> Anular algoritmo BID I18N

big <big> </big> Estilo de texto grande

blockquote

<blockquote>

</blockquote>

Cita larga

body Opcional Opcional Cuerpo del documento

br <br> Prohibido Salto de línea forzado

button <button> </button> Botóncaption <caption> </caption> Título de tablacenter <center> </center> D L Forma

abreviada de DIV align=center

cite <cite> </cite> Citacode <code> </code> Fragmento de

código de computadora

col <col> Prohibido Columna de una tabla

colgroup <colgroup>

Opcional Grupo de columnas de una tabla

dd <dd> Opcional Descripción de una definición

del <del> </del> Texto borradodfn <dfn> </dfn> Definición

Page 7: Trabajo de html sandy gutierrez

dir <dir> </dir> D L Lista tipo directorio

div <div> </div> Contenedor genérico de idioma/estilo

dl <dl> </dl> Lista de definiciones

dt <dt> Opcional Término definido

em <em> </em> Énfasisfieldset <fieldset> </fieldset> Grupo de

controles de un formulario

font <font> </font> D L Cambio local de la fuente

form <form> </form> Formulario interactivo

frame <frame> Prohibido F Subventanaframeset <frameset

> </frameset>

F Subdivisión en ventanas

h1 <h1> </h1> Encabezadoh2 <h2> </h2> Encabezadoh3 <h3> </h3> Encabezadoh4 <h4> </h4> Encabezadoh5 <h5> </h5> Encabezadoh6 <h6> </h6> Encabezadohead Opcional Opcional Cabecera del

documentohr <hr> Prohibido Separador

horizontalhtml Opcional Opcional Elemento raíz

del documentoi <i> </i> Estilo de texto

en itálicaiframe <iframe> </iframe> L Subventana en

líneaimg <img> Prohibido Imagen

incluidainput <input> Prohibido Control de

formularioins <ins> </ins> Texto

insertadoisindex <isindex> Prohibido D L Entrada de

texto en una sola línea con

Page 8: Trabajo de html sandy gutierrez

indicadorkbd <kbd> </kbd> Texto que

debe introducir el usuario

label <label> </label> Texto del rótulo de un campo de formulario

legend <legend> </legend> Leyenda de un grupo de campos

li <li> Opcional Objeto de listalink <link> Prohibido Un vínculo

independiente del medio

map <map> </map> Mapa de imágenes en el lado del cliente

menu <menu> </menu> D L Lista tipo menú

meta <meta> Prohibido Metainformación genérica

noframes

<noframes>

</noframes>

F Contenedor de contenidos alternativos para la representación no basada en marcos

noscript <noscript>

</noscript>

Contenedor de contenidos alternativos para la representación no basada en scripts

object <object> </object> Objeto incluido genérico

optgroup

<optgroup>

</optgroup>

Grupo de opciones

option <option> Opcional Opción

Page 9: Trabajo de html sandy gutierrez

seleccionable

p <p> Opcional Párrafoparam <param

> ol <ol> </ol> Lista

ordenada

Prohibido Valor de propiedad con nombre

pre <pre> </pre> Texto preformateado

q <q> </q> Cita corta en línea

s <s> </s> D L Estilo de texto tachado

samp <samp> </samp> Ejemplo de salida de programas, scripts, etc.

script <script> </script> Sentencias de script

select <select> </select> Selector de opciones

small <small> </small> Estilo de texto pequeño

span <span> </span> Contenedor genérico de idioma/estilo

strike <strike> </strike> D L Estilo de texto tachado

strong <strong>

</strong>

Énfasis fuerte

style <style> </style> Información de estilo

sub <sub> </sub> Subíndicesup <sup> </sup> Superíndic

Page 10: Trabajo de html sandy gutierrez

etable <table> </table> tbody Opcional Opcional Cuerpo de

tablatd <td> Opcional Celda de

datos de una tabla

textarea

<textarea>

</textarea>

Campo de texto multilínea

tfoot <tfoot> Opcional Pie de tabla

th <th> Opcional Celda de encabezado de tabla

thead <thead> Opcional Cabecera de tabla

title <title> </title> Título del documento

tr <tr> Opcional Fila de una tabla

tt <tt> </tt> Estilo de texto de teletipo o monoespacio

u <u> </u> D L Estilo de texto subrayado

ul <ul> </ul> Lista no ordenada

var <var> </var> Variable o argumento de un programa